Practical Seller Notes for Implementation
Before you rush to list these items, there are several practical steps every experienced embroiderer should take. Even though the product description mentions it is a DIGITAL FILE of a printable JPG download for use in sublimation or graphic design, using it for embroidery requires specific preparation.
First, you must test the design before listing products. Create a sample stitch-out on the actual fabric you intend to sell. This allows you to check the stitch density and ensure the background does not cause puckering. If the background is too dense, it might require a heavier stabilizer to support the stitches properly.
You also need to verify the hoop size. Since this is a background, it may span a large area. Ensure your machine can handle the dimensions without requiring you to re-hoop awkwardly, which can ruin the alignment. Check the thread colors available in the design and compare them to your stock. Sometimes, a design looks great on screen but loses impact with limited thread options.
Another critical step is checking readability at listing-thumbnail size. Zoom out and see if the details of the background remain clear. If the texture disappears or becomes muddy when viewed small, it might not work well for mobile shoppers. Additionally, confirm the Creative Fabrica licensing terms before selling finished goods. Understanding what you are allowed to do with the digital embroidery file is vital for protecting your business from legal issues.
Finally, remember that this is a background element. It is most effective when paired with a focal point. Use it to frame text, logos, or other motifs. Do not let the background overshadow the main message of your design.
